The best Lightning cables for your iPhone or iPad

Your Lightning cable is your iOS device’s lifeline, used to charge and transfer data to your Apple mobile device. To keep your tech running reliably, you need a high-quality, eight-pin cable that won’t crack or splinter. Light and flexible as they are, it’s always helpful to tote around a spare cable or two. You never know when you’ll need to charge your devices while you’re on the go. iPhone 15 Tipped to Feature a USB Type-C Port Instead of Lightning Connector

iPhone 15 is rumoured to come with the USB Type-C port ending more than a decade-old relationship with the Lightning connector port. Apple's decision to adopt the USB Type-C port for iPhone models can improve the data transfer and charging speed, but final numbers are said to depend on iOS support. The market is expected to focus more on Apple ecosystem's existing USB Type-C related suppliers for the next one to two years. Ford hints at bringing LFP batteries to Mustang Mach-E and F-150 Lightning

Ford is working on bringing iron-phosphate (LFP) batteries its first-generation electric vehicles, like the Mustang Mach-E and F-150 Lightning. It would help alleviate battery cell supply concerns as the automaker ramps up its EV production. Iron phosphate (LFP) batteries, which don’t use nickel or cobalt, are traditionally cheaper and safer, but they offer less energy density which means less efficiency and shorter range for electric vehicles. iPhone 15 will switch from Lightning to USB-C, insider claims

Apple may finally be planning to make one of the most commonly requested changes to the iPhone in 2023. According to TF International Securities analyst Ming-Chi Kuo, the iPhone 15 will ditch the Lightning port in favor of USB-C. Kuo reached this conclusion after sending a survey to his supply chain sources.
